I also own all the Chanel makeup brushes (except the two that I still want, which will soon be mine). The point is that I didn't get the COMPLETE look for $224 but I did get a lot of HOT stuff:

Three shadows at $28.50 each: Abricot, Island and Cinnamon.

GORGEOUS Blush at $42.00: Joues Contrast Powder Blush in In Love. I am def head over heels in love with this color!! It's a peachy/pink! *Swoon*

HOT HOT HOT lipstick. lip gloss and lipliner. They are all a bright effing awesome corally color!!! Lipstick is part of the Rouge Allure collection in shade Exotic for $30. Gloss is Aqualumiere Gloss in Neully for $27.00. Awesome glossy lipliner (goes on so smooth) is Le Crayon Gloss in Rose Honey for $30.00.
